Need Spain Schengen Visa Appointment?
Whether it is some of the best beaches in Europe or the Mediterranean plazas with their bar-crammed side streets or the rich footballing heritage of the great clubs in Madrid and Catalonia, whatever your reason for beckoning, Spain is undeniably a country of incredible diversity and culture. Imagine having packed and been ready for adventure[…]